Exploring the Symmetrical Triangle Top (Bearish) Pattern in Stock Trading

The Symmetrical Triangle Top pattern is a pivotal formation in technical analysis, particularly in identifying bearish trends. This article aims to provide a comprehensive understanding of the Symmetrical Triangle Top pattern, combining its technical characteristics with the psychological aspects of pattern trading.

Formation and Characteristics of the Symmetrical Triangle Top Pattern

The Symmetrical Triangle Top pattern emerges when a security's price action fails to retest previous highs or lows, resulting in the formation of two converging trend lines. This pattern is a key indicator in technical analysis, suggesting a significant impending price movement, either upwards or downwards, depending on which trend line is breached first.

Market Context and Significance

Commonly seen in directionless markets, the Symmetrical Triangle Top pattern indicates a narrowing market range, signifying a lack of dominance by either bulls or bears. This pattern often leads up to a decisive breakout, accompanied by substantial trading volumes, as market participants either pour in or sell out, determining the direction of the price movement.

Trading Strategy for the Symmetrical Triangle Top Pattern

Trade Opportunities

For traders observing a breakout from the bottom boundary of the pattern, a bearish trend is suggested. Strategies such as short-selling the security or buying put options at the downward breakout price level are recommended. The breakout level, typically the lowest low within the triangle, is crucial for determining the entry point.

Exit Strategy

The target price for exiting the trade is calculated by subtracting the pattern's height, measured from the highest high to the lowest low, from the breakout level. This calculation helps traders in determining an effective exit point to maximize potential gains.

Risk Management

To mitigate potential losses, especially when the price unexpectedly reverses direction, traders are advised to place a stop order at or above the breakout price. This strategy helps in managing the risks associated with sudden market movements.

The Psychology Behind Pattern Trading

Anticipation, Prediction, and Reaction

Pattern trading is rooted in psychological processes, involving anticipation, prediction, and reaction to price movements. Traders rely on historical patterns to forecast future market behavior, believing that past trends can offer insights into upcoming market dynamics.

Seeking Predictability in Volatility

In volatile stock markets, patterns like the Symmetrical Triangle Top provide a framework for interpreting and anticipating market behavior. This quest for predictability is a fundamental aspect of human psychology in trading.

Pattern Recognition as a Cognitive Process

Recognizing patterns is not merely a technical skill but involves cognitive abilities, including memory, attention to detail, and analytical thinking. The ability to spot patterns like the Symmetrical Triangle Top is crucial for making informed trading decisions.

Influence of Confirmation Bias

Traders' decision-making can be influenced by confirmation bias, where they may prefer patterns that have yielded success in the past. This bias can reinforce confidence in specific patterns, sometimes at the expense of overlooking contradictory market signals.

Emotional Response to Market Movements

The anticipation of a pattern's breakout point, such as in the Symmetrical Triangle Top pattern, can evoke emotional responses like excitement or anxiety among traders. Managing these emotions is crucial for maintaining objectivity in trading decisions.

Risk and Reward Assessment

Pattern trading involves a continual assessment of the potential risks and rewards. Traders must evaluate whether the expected gain from a predicted price movement justifies the risk of the pattern not materializing as expected.

The Symmetrical Triangle Top (Bearish) pattern is an essential tool in a trader's repertoire, especially in identifying bearish trends in the stock market. Understanding this pattern requires not only technical acumen but also an understanding of the psychological dynamics involved in trading. By recognizing and effectively responding to such patterns, traders can enhance their ability to make strategic decisions, combining technical expertise with psychological insight in the challenging and dynamic world of stock trading.
